family photos should be fun! | family photographer la quinta ca

 We actually took these photographs last month, but I still wanted to share… We were able to get all of these great images and more during a holiday”mini” session. It was only about a 1/2 hour session (maybe even a little less!)… we explored the park, we played, and walked away with great images and fun family memories. I truly believe that family photos shouldn’t be a painful event. I really, really try to keep it fun & lively for everyone. You just can’t force kids to pose and “smile”, trust me (I’ve learned the hard way), it doesn’t work! And I know, sometimes as a parent, you worry that your time with the photographer will be wasted if you can’t get baby to smile BIG. Don’t worry, relax, you don’t have to stress out about that. I come to each session prepared with a few tricks up my sleeve, a few ideas to get the party started : ) . So, if you’re ready to have fun, your children will be too. And that is when the magic happens! See below – there was no begging or bribing here,  just good times! Enjoy ♥
